SEOUL — North Korea on Monday denounced what it called a move by the United States to introduce a nuclear-powered ballistic missile submarine into waters near the Korean peninsula, saying it creates a situation that would bring a nuclear conflict closer to the brings reality.

North Korea also claimed that US reconnaissance aircraft recently violated its airspace near the east coast, an unnamed spokesperson for the Ministry of National Defense is quoted in a statement released by the official KCNA news agency.

“There is no guarantee that a shocking incident in which a US Air Force strategic reconnaissance aircraft is shot down over the Baltic Sea will not happen,” the spokesman said.

The statement cited previous incidents in which the North shot down or intercepted US aircraft on the border with South Korea and off its coast. North Korea has often complained about US surveillance flights near the peninsula.

The moves by the United States to introduce strategic nuclear assets to the Korean Peninsula are blatant nuclear blackmail against North Korea and regional countries and pose a serious threat to peace, KCNA said.

“It is up to future US actions whether an extreme situation occurs in the Korean Peninsula that no one wants, and the United States will be held fully responsible if an unexpected situation arises,” it said.

A US nuclear-powered submarine carrying cruise missiles arrived in South Korea’s Busan port in June.

In April, the leaders of South Korea and the United States agreed that a US Navy ballistic missile submarine will visit South Korea for the first time since the 1980s, but no timetable for such a visit has been given.

It was part of a plan to boost the deployment of US strategic assets aimed at a more effective response to North Korea’s threats and weapons tests in defense of its ally South Korea, as agreed by the two leaders.

The switch to sailing nuclear submarines has created a “very dangerous situation that makes it impossible for us to realistically not accept the worst-case scenario of a nuclear confrontation,” the North Korean statement said.

In June, a US B-52 strategic bomber participated in air military exercises with South Korea in a show of force following North Korea’s failed launch of a spy satellite in late May. REUTERS
